#a566bc h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#a566bc is composed of 64.7% red, 40%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.2% cyan, 45.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 284 degrees, a saturation of 39.1% and a lightness of 56.9%. #a566bc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ffccff with #4b0079.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#a566bc color description : Slightly desaturated violet.

The hexadecimal color #a566bc has RGB values of R:165, G:102,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 10839740.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09050b is the darkest color, while #fdfcfe is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919092 is the less saturated color, while #c12bf7 is the most saturated one.
